When people say a person is a "tweaker," what drug does that mean they use?


Question:
This guy at my work used to be really fat, and now he's average weight. EVERYONE compliments him on his success, but..a few people who know a little more about what's going on tell me he's a tweaker. What does that mean he uses?

A "tweaker" is someone who is using crystal methamphetamines and/or some type of speed. Other names for crystal meth are glass, ice, crystal, crank, meth, tweak, bump, line..

It eats the enamel off of the teeth, the calcium out of the bones, the cartilage from between the joints, and can cause holes in the lungs and the lining of stomach and intestines. Up to 30 years after a person STARTS using meth, they can suffer heart attacks, aneurysms, strokes, and mental disorders.
